WebThe scar tissue that forms the contracture is composed of a protein network called collagen. Collagenase is an enzyme that breaks up the collagen, which can then loosen the contracted tissue to restore finger mobility. Collagenase is directly injected into the contracted "cord" of scar tissue that causes the Dupuytren's contracture. WebDec 28, 2024 · Myelofibrosis usually develops slowly. The walls of the main heart chambers become thin and stretched and cannot pump blood around the body properly. ps vita henkaku new psn accountWebJan 19, 2024 · During breast augmentation surgery, a pocket is created in the breast tissue and the implant is inserted into that pocket. Sometimes, as the tissue begins to heal after surgery, a capsule of scar tissue forms to hold the implant in place. When this scar tissue squeezes the implant, it causes the breast to harden or become distorted. haqqani on pakistanWebhttp://www.HealingScarTissue.comHardened scars form for a variety of reasons.
